Video transcript
To access TV channels on your smart TV, ensure it's connected to the internet. Install apps like your preferred streaming services or traditional broadcaster apps from the app store. Utilize an HD antenna to access local channels if your TV supports it. Subscribe to streaming services providing live TV, like Hulu Live or Sling TV. Check compatibility with your cable provider's app if you have existing cable service. Explore built-in features, as some smart TVs offer direct access to live TV broadcasts through integrated platforms.
Questions and answers
What apps can I install to access TV channels on my smart TV?
You can install various streaming service apps such as Hulu Live, Sling TV, or your preferred broadcaster's app to access TV channels.
Do I need an internet connection to watch channels on a smart TV?
Yes, your smart TV needs to be connected to the internet to access streaming services and apps for watching channels.
Can I use an HD antenna with my smart TV?
Yes, if your smart TV supports it, you can use an HD antenna to access local TV channels without an internet connection.
What if I have a cable subscription? Can I watch TV on my smart TV?
You can check if your cable provider offers an app compatible with your smart TV for streaming live TV channels.
